Transaction ebdbb7e94adbac12c5fa37bf339b56f1c36cf76ff5645fd982b58b06826fe966
1 Input
1 Output
-
ebdbb7e94adbac12c5fa37bf339b56f1c36cf76ff5645fd982b58b06826fe966:0
- value
- 10904325
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e2b281f43178f58461cdfd662fddb6e133be931 OP_EQUAL
- address
- 3EejaNAFY1c2Bug4m3greX8RccABBqt7Sw